The growing population of adults with congenital heart disease (ACHD) highlights the urgent need for specialized care. Most congenital heart surgeries are palliative rather than curative, resulting in residual lesions, complications such as heart failure and arrhythmias, and non-cardiac issues requiring lifelong management. Unique pathophysiological features, such as systemic right ventricle and Fontan circulation, differentiate ACHD from acquired cardiovascular diseases, posing challenges in applying existing evidence-based treatments. Heart failure is a leading cause of mortality in ACHD, necessitating tailored management strategies, including emerging pharmacological treatments like ARNI and SGLT-2 inhibitors, as well as non-pharmacological options like cardiac resynchronization therapy and heart transplantation. Arrhythmias, including atrial tachycardia and ventricular arrhythmias, are major causes of morbidity and mortality, emphasizing the importance of timely evaluation and intervention, such as catheter ablation. Surgical management demands precise risk assessment and a multidisciplinary team approach. End-of-life care is particularly complex, as ACHD patients often struggle with disease awareness and decision-making due to lifelong medical dependence. Collaboration among specialists, including cardiologists, pediatricians, and palliative care providers, is essential to address these challenges.
